The Mackay Bar Reset

ABOUT this event:

July 31st – Aug 3rd, 2025

The Mackay Bar Reset is designed for corporate leaders or individuals wanting to reset how they lead, regain energy, clarity, and intention in their lives and leadership. Join us for a four day, three night all-inclusive adventure where we focus on GOOD ENERGY, GOOD FOOD, and GOOD HEALTH. Jet boat adventures, beach and relaxation time, hiking, fishing all the while gaining inset on how to reclaim energy, strengthen mindset, lead with intension, understand how to fuel your body with clean food and household products, and understand the five metabolic mastery tools taught by Dr. Casey Means in her renowned book, GOOD ENERGY.

meet your hosts: Amy Young (renowned chef)

Food Is Education – Each meal is an experience

We’re thrilled to welcome Amy Young as the culinary heart of this retreat. Amy is a celebrated chef and educator who owned and operated the award-winning Lotus Café in Jackson Hole, WY — a high-end organic restaurant known for its nourishing, inclusive approach to food. Her work has been featured on Food Network’s Diners, Drive-Ins and Dives with Guy Fieri, and in outlets like The New York Times, Vogue, and Travel + Leisure. Amy has a rare gift: she creates meals that are both deeply nourishing and tailored to all dietary needs — turning food into an experience of healing, connection, and education.
